Abstract
An oil circulation type motor may include an oil circulating device having cooling oil chambers which are formed along the circumference of a stator core and through which cooling oil pumped by an oil pump is introduced and discharged, wherein cooling oil is introduced into the cooling oil chambers, wets a stator coil wound around the stator core, and is then discharged from the cooling oil chambers.
